Definition
Whole-grain rice with the bran and germ intact, offering a nutty flavor, chewy texture, and higher fiber content than white rice.

Per 100g cookedChef’s Secret
For perfectly fluffy brown rice, soak it for 30 minutes before cooking to reduce cooking time and ensure even texture, then use a 1.75:1 water-to-rice ratio.
Substitutions
White Long Grain Rice
Similar shape, but milder flavor, softer texture, and less fiber; cooks faster.
Wild Rice Blend
Nutty and chewy, offers more complex flavor and texture, good fiber, but longer cook time.
Quinoa
A complete protein, quicker cooking, but has a distinct fluffy texture and slight bitterness.
Farro
Chewy texture and nutty flavor, good for grain bowls, contains gluten.
Buying Guide
Choose organic when possible. Store in an airtight container in a cool, dark place to preserve freshness.
